Description

Nearby young associations are ideal laboratories to study the early evolution of cool stars. The traceback method can constrain the age of an association from astrometric and kinematic data alone, circumventing the need for stellar evolution models. Previous traceback age estimates have, however, often been incompatible with other age-dating methods. We applied the Kinematic Age for Nearby Young Associations (kanya) traceback analysis tool on core samples, free of contaminants such as unresolved multiple systems, of carefully vetted members of the Tucana–Horologium (THA), Columba (COL), and Carina (CAR) associations, using data from Gaia Data Release 3 (DR3) data products and other kinematic surveys included in the Montreal Open Clusters and Associations (MOCA) Database, in order to test whether the traceback method can be used successfully on 40–50 Myr-old associations. Several systematic biases, including gravitational redshift, convective blueshift, and the bias on traceback ages due to random measurement errors, were accounted for. We found that the mean length of all branches between members and the trace of the spatial covariance matrix are the most robust and generalizable association size metrics among those that were tested. We obtained reliable constraints on the traceback ages: $44.8_{-7.0}^{+2.1}$ Myr for THA, and $28.4_{-2.9}^{+1.8}$ Myr for COL and CAR. These results are compatible with previous age estimates for THA, COL, and CAR computed with the isochrones and lithium depletion boundary (LDB) methods.
